caching, sample location services, an SMS service, simple social service, The OpenStack architecture had endeavored to make each project as hardware. To maximize its impact, many of these same companies are also After this course, participants will be able to perform the following: Managing Guest Virtual Machines with OpenStack Compute, Components of an OpenStack Cloud—Part Two, Advanced Software-Defined Networking with Neutron, Get expert training when and how you want it, View free, interactive web seminars on the latest embedded software trends and technologies from Wind River®, Access the support network that provides a wide variety of useful information, Access documentation, tutorials, defects, and patches, Share questions and answers about Wind River products, Evaluate OpenStack's capabilities for private and public cloud services, Use OpenStack to create and deploy enterprise infrastructure-as-a-service, Orchestrate virtual machine provisioning and management, Administer and troubleshoot OpenStack Neutron, Ceph, and Nova services, Architects, system administrators, and DevOps staff who design, deploy, and operate OpenStack clouds, Administrators and developers deploying applications and infrastructure on OpenStack, IT professionals in sales, marketing, and services seeking to expand their knowledge of cloud services and OpenStack. manage LANs with capabilities for virtual LAN (VLAN), Dynamic Host The software writes files and other objects through the dashboard. and Orchestration Specification for Cloud Applications (TOSCA) standard. also capabilities for advanced functionality, including high availability, monitoring data. The course covers full lifecycle OpenStack services, including deployment, administration, usage, and distributed storage. ... Openstack.org is powered by Rackspace Cloud Computing. Your feedback helps influence the direction of development. Its compute instances usually require some It is also possible to back up Functions exist to register new virtual OpenStack Cloud to provide a pre-integrated, optimized and sup-ported configuration that is ready for production deployment . alphabetically (see Table 1). which developers can create cloud-centric applications that rely on hosted composite cloud applications i a RESTful API. That’s why openstack is the strategic choice of many types of organizations from service providers looking to offer cloud computing services on standard hardware, to companies looking to deploy private cloud, to large enterprises deploying a global cloud solution across multiple continents. form, but a lot more is coming down the line. based on both the year of release and the major version of the release ... and many users in the telecom and retail industries are working now to advance the edge computing use case with OpenStack. For example, IBM's open cloud architecture incorporates the OASIS Topology In The architecture also enables horizontal scalability, because OpenStack is a collection of open source software modules that provides a framework to create and manage both public cloud and private cloud infrastructure. In this course you will become adept at managing and using private and public clouds with OpenStack, and develop hands-on experience with essential commands, automation, and troubleshooting. also a mechanism to cache VM images on compute nodes for faster cloud is likely to require virtually all the functionality to operate images that are assigned to an extensible set of back-end stores, storage back end. Written in Python, it creates an The project has a mission to create an open SDN It fulfills two main requirements of the cloud: massive scalability and simplicity of implementation. one or more data centers, ensuring data replication and integrity across Search. OpenStack Object Storage (Swift) is based on the Rackspace Cloud Files platform. documentation refers to. OpenStack is one of the top 3 most active open source projects and manages 15 million compute cores Learn more. Stay tuned for additional content in this series. We founded OpenStack with NASA in 2010, operate the world’s largest OpenStack cloud and have experience scaling OpenStack clouds to thousands of nodes. clouds on a massive scale. Using the python-novaclient command line interfaces, radosgw for Swift-compatible object access, Highly available OpenStack reference architecture, Deployment considerations for cloud monitoring, Knowledge of Linux system administration, concepts and administration for network, storage, and virtual systems. Basic architecture¶ OpenStack Glance has a client-server architecture that provides a REST API to the user through which requests to the server can be performed. Configuration Protocol, and Internet Protocol version 6. OpenStack began in 2010 as a joint project of RackSpace Hosting and NASA. Orchestrator. It handles the Many readers of these articles have a keen interest in IBM, so it's worth highlighting how important OpenStack is to the company. http://www.ibm.com/developerworks/cloud/library/?series_title_by=Discover+OpenStack, static.content.url=http://www.ibm.com/developerworks/js/artrating/, ArticleTitle=Discover OpenStack: Architectures, functions, and interactions, OpenStack OpenStack : OpenStack is a cloud operating sysetem that controls large pools of compute , storage and networking resources throughout a datacenter. For example, the first release of 2011 (Bexar) had the 2011.1 ... Openstack.org is powered by Rackspace Cloud Computing. Imagine you're building a house: Cloud infrastructure incorporates all the materials, while cloud architecture is the blueprint. A typical OpenStack implementation will integrate most if not all of OpenStack was initiated by Rackspace Cloud and NASA in 2010, who integrated RAM, network adapters, and hard drives, with functions to improve OpenStack is an open source cloud operating stack that was born from Rackspace and NASA and became a global success, developed by scores of people around the globe and backed by some of the leading players in the cloud space today. by popular vote at the OpenStack design summits and generally identify Cloud Edge Computing: Beyond the Data Center. dashboard which they can also use to create resources and assign them to industry endorsement. plug-ins exist for other platforms, as well, including Ceph, NetApp, Prior to this announcement, IBM had actively invested in object-based (Swift). As of the Grizzly release, OpenStack consists of seven core projects: OpenStack Compute (Nova) controls the cloud computing fabric (the core descriptions in the OpenStack Heat project. plug-in to the OpenStack Networking service. the intersection of compute and storage. It is also used to manage the high-performance bare metal configurations.It is coded in Python and has utilized many pre-defined libraries to deliver robust functioning. notification agent - daemon designed to listen to notifications on message queue, convert them to Events and Samples, and apply pipeline actions. Log In. that year. addition to discovery, registration, and activation services, it has Its purpose is to well as a catalog of OpenStack services they can access. grow dramatically and quickly, often with two or more releases per year. OpenStack is highly configurable: the user can choose whether or not to implement … to obtain all the usage information they need across the suite of Block storage lends itself well to scenarios with strict utilization and automation. These permutations of perspectives drive a paucity of aligned user stories to share with the OpenStack and StarlingX communities. Introducing OpenStack and its components for cloud computing OpenStack is an open source software that is used for creating private and public clouds. Floating IP Authentication Module, Lightweight Directory Access Protocol (LDAP), or We are hiring technical cloud solutions architect to help our customers and partners to facilitate their transformation from traditional infrastructure to cloud computing with scalability, security, and reliability. platform based on industry standards. Through these plug-ins, it's able to facilitate multiple forms of role-based resource permissions, and integrate with other directories like Bare metal compute hosts. handled, and an OpenStack Dashboard (Horizon) was introduced to subset of the functionality and integrate it with other systems and and RabbitMQ. single registry. Folsom increased the count two further notches. Each objective focuses on practical requirements for managing and using an OpenStack cloud. Rackspace, Red Hat, and SUSE. demand. form of persistent storage which can be either block-based (Cinder) or Openstack Foundation, a non-profit organization, looking after community-building and project development, manages the OpenStack. and detach block devices from/to servers. In this chapter, you can find details about why OpenStack-Ansible was architected in this way. separate project, initially called Quantum and later OpenStack is growing at an unprecedented rate, and there is incredible demand for individuals who have experience managing this cloud platform. The Essex release added two more core projects. performance constraints, such as databases and file systems. but are more commonly referred to by their project names, Nova and Swift, is still a work in progress. OpenStack is an open source cloud computing infrastructure software project and is one of the three most active open source projects in the world. OpenStack is represented by three core open source projects (as shown in Figure 2): Nova (compute), Swift (object storage), and Glance (VM repository). for some time: OpenStack Metering (Ceilometer) and OpenStack Orchestration TOSCA is an open standard being developed by IBM, SAP, HP, Rackspace, and There are The popular open source software allows users to easily consume compute, network, and storage resources that have been traditionally controlled by disparate methods and tools by various teams in IT departments, big and small. releases extend the dot notation further (for example, 2011.3.1). It allows group of industry leaders (see Related to the VMs. Try our OpenStack is a set of software tools for building and managing cloud computing platforms for public and private clouds. It supports an extensible set of counters that are variety of formats, including VHD (Microsoft(® Hyper-V®), VDI IBM announced its Many readers of these articles have a keen interest in IBM, so it's worth Read the whitepaper. The API server exposes a Representational State Transfer that are stored in OpenStack to rapidly launch compute instances on The OpenStack Cloud Computing: Architecture Guide is not a tutorial on using OpenStack. One of the most exciting things about OpenStack is that it continues to IBM and Red Hat — the next chapter of open innovation. Toggle navigation. geographical entities near the location of the summit. both traceable and auditable. Find helpful customer reviews and review ratings for OpenStack Cloud Computing: Architecture Guide at Amazon.com. Note that Nova provides not only an OpenStack API for management … OpenStack Identity Management (Keystone) manages a directory of users as Cloud users can manage their storage requirements the graphical UI that administrators can most easily use to manage all the An overall summary of Ceilometer’s logical architecture. (Heat). As mentioned, the Austin release consisted only of two core projects: projects. Cloud architecture is how all the components and capabilities necessary to build a cloud are connected in order to deliver an online platform on which applications can run. consortium-led Infrastructure as a Service software stack in the world OpenStack is a an open source cloud operating system managing compute, storage, and networking resources throughout a datacenter using APIs OpenStack is one of the top 3 most active open source projects and manages 15 million compute cores Learn more with a variety of other directory services, such as Pluggable In addition, it offers a distributed object store and a wide This is an overview of OpenStack. Developers often refer to the release by its codename which is ordered As a result, much of the information publicly available on the technology their account. Architecture¶ Many operational requirements have been taken into consideration for the design of the OpenStack-Ansible project. For example, the OpenFlow controller "Edge" is a term with varying definitions depending on the particular problem a deployer is attempting to solve. release contained two new projects that many have been looking forward to It delivers a single point of contact for billing systems It is intended to control resources in a datacenter and has a dashboard to be managed or it can be done through the OpenStack API. Cloud hosts. It is basically a virtualization hypervisor. OpenStack is a suite of projects that combine into a software-defined environment to be consumed using cloud friendly tools and techniques. supporters, including many of the industry's largest organizations. The system provides interfaces to create, attach, Networking (Neutron), formerly called Quantum, includes the capability to Rather than providing the authentication itself, Keystone can integrate Software . addresses allow users to assign (and reassign) fixed external IP addresses * OpenStack is a free and open source software platform for cloud computing. Austin was the first major Each release has incorporated new functionality, added documentation, and off the networking components (also previously included in Nova) into a Nova can arguably be considered the core OpenStack. Initiated by Rackspace Cloud and the National Aeronautics and Space Its application programming interfaces (APIs) provide compute orchestration for an approach that attempts to be agnostic not only of physical hardware but also of hypervisors. orchestration of workloads. OpenStack Identity makes it possible for administrators to configure can access either through programmatic requests or by logging in to the collaborative project under the Linux® Foundation dedicated to As part of the community, IBM has provided numerous direct OpenStack Image Service (Glance) provides support for VM images, If you aren't familiar with it, OpenStack This three-day expert-led course consists of lectures and lab sessions. contributions. specifically the system disks to be used in launching VM instances. range of optional functionality, including a network controller, For example, the Havana Read the whitepaper. Already registered? Its technology is hypervisor independent and Its live VM management has functions to launch, resize, suspend, stop, and Cinder volumes by using the snapshot capability. In a cloud providing bare metal compute services to tenants via ironic, these hosts will run the bare metal tenant workloads. Read honest and unbiased product reviews from our users. Minor abstraction layer for virtualizing commodity server resources such as CPU, Swift is a distributed storage system primarily for static data, such as VM (API). (REST)-ful interface with which users can list and fetch virtual disk It is managed by the OpenStack Foundation, a non-profit organization that oversees both development and community building. It is easiest to understand the OpenStack project with some historical expose a central authentication mechanism across all OpenStack components. Separately, many other IBM cloud-based activities The OpenStack architecture organizes the model of cloud computing to include resource assignment, machine-image registration and control, and data storage. members. Enhance your career with this course in IaaS Cloud Computing With OpenStack MasterClass - Part 1. OpenStack Compute (Nova) and OpenStack Object Storage (Swift). OpenStack is one of the top 3 most active open source projects and ... operators have been pioneers in the evolution of cloud computing out to the edge. Horizon is is able to replenish the content from other active systems to new cluster component of an infrastructure service). creating an open and transparent approach to Software-Defined Networking (see Related topics). OpenStack is growing at an unprecedented rate, and there is incredible demand for individuals who have experience managing this cloud platform. Typically the cloud hosts run on bare metal but this is not mandatory. Since its founding, developers to define application deployment patterns that orchestrate sophisticated multifactor systems. Pilot Production Rack Configuration Introduction Delivering a fully orchestrated OpenStack cloud can be Another area of involvement is its Platinum sponsorship of OpenDaylight, a The cloud hosts run the OpenStack control plane, network, monitoring, storage, and virtualised compute services. OAuth. Nova, or OpenStack Compute, provides the management of VM instances across a network of servers. OpenStack is an open source software that allows for the deployment and management of a cloud infrastructure as a service (IaaS) platform. This section describes some of the choices you need to consider when designing and building your compute nodes. Edge Computing: Next Steps in Architecture, Design and Testing. OpenStack is a free open standard cloud computing platform, mostly deployed as infrastructure-as-a-service (IaaS) in both public and private clouds where virtual servers and other resources are made available to users. Compute nodes form the resource core of the OpenStack Compute cloud, providing the processing, memory, network and storage resources to run instances. highlighting how important OpenStack is to the company. Nexenta, and SolidFire. ... daemon designed to poll OpenStack services and build Meters. IBM cloud products offer an open source Platform as a Service platform on At the same time, a separate team its pool, so users can employ commodity hard disks and servers rather than has also enlarged the number of projects that form part of the initiative. images, backups, and archives. open cloud architecture in March 2013 and committed to basing all of its In understanding OpenStack, it's important to keep in mind that the system documentation. A catalog contains a list of all of the deployed services in a Openstack has one of the biggest communities. topics). Bexar OpenStack supports both private and public cloud deployments. LDAP. capabilities for snapshots and backups. It also covers service administration across all core services. Core OpenStack services covered include computing (using Nova), networking (using Neutron), distributed storage (using Ceph), orchestration (using Heat), telemetry (using Ceilometer), imaging (using Glance), and identity (using Keystone). stream virtual disk images. projects. Users can define auto-scaling, and nested stacks. and Open Virtualization Format. Keystone handles the management of authorized users, and Neutron It is an introduction to building a cloud based on OpenStack technologies. OpenStack is a software for building and managing cloud-computing platforms for public and private clouds. networks, subnets, and routers to configure their internal topology, and improved the ease of deployment in an incremental fashion, but the roadmap consistently. centralized policies that apply across users and systems. Ceilometer is a mechanism for centralized collection of metering and The Open Infrastructure Summit, held virtually for the first time, takes place October 19-23 and includes more than 100 sessions around infrastructure use cases like cloud computing, edge computing, hardware enablement, private & hybrid cloud and security. is a collection of open source technology projects cosponsored by a broad OpenStack includes a large set of modular and extensible components with broad industry support. floating IP address ranges, Cinder volumes, Keystone users). A Glance Domain Controller manages the internal server operations that is divided into … Backed by some of the biggest companies in software development and hosting, as well as thousands of individual community members, many think that OpenStack is the future of cloud computing. and plug-ins. disk images, query for information on publicly available disk images, and Prior to this announcement, IBM had actively invested in integrating its products with OpenStack and made significant contributions to the OpenStack community, helping the software meet enterprise and cloud s… authentication ranging from simple user name-password credentials to The course emphasizes both architectural concepts and practical demonstrations, with students performing hands-on labs for each objective. release, followed by Bexar, Cactus, and Diablo. Heat is a template-based orchestration engine for OpenStack. defines the networks that provide connectivity between the components. then allocate IP addresses and VLANs to these networks. They can create It is the largest open source SDN project to date, with broad (VirtualBox), VMDK (VMware), qcow2 (Qemu/Kernel-based Virtual Machine), many others. (Keystone) isolated the user management elements that Nova had previously Administration (NASA), OpenStack is currently the most popular complemented these with an Image Service (Glance) that in many ways forms OpenStack Glance has a client-server architecture that provides a REST API to the user through which requests to the server can be performed. respectively. More than 500 companies have joined the project since. Thousands of attendees are expected to participate, representing 30+ open source communities and more than 110 countries. more expensive equipment. code from NASA's Nebula platform as well as Rackspace's Cloud Files this independence shouldn't mask the fact that a fully functional private The most common storage to use with Cinder is Linux server storage, but OpenStack components. OpenStack is an open source … … These codenames are chosen OpenStack Block Storage (Cinder) manages block-level storage that compute Participants receive individual guidance from an expert engineer who has extensive experience with OpenStack technologies. smoothly, and the elements will need to be tightly integrated. Define a reference architecture for edge and far edge deployments including OpenStack services and other open source components as building blocks. Join the edge computing initiative. perspective on how it has evolved. reboot through integration with a set of supported hypervisors. authentication manager, management dashboard, and block storage. The basic components that make up the architecture of OpenStack are:Compute (Nova)Compute is one of the most important and mandatory components of OpenStack. It is possible to implement it in its current indirectly support OpenStack. Users can provide both private and public images to the service in a (SDN). manage files programmatically through an application programming interface Current platinum members include IBM, AT&T, Canonical, HP, Nebula, accommodate most OpenStack resource types (for example, Nova instances and cloud offerings on OpenStack, starting with IBM SmartCloud® Openstack cloud is also supported by community members, many of whom believe that the future of cloud computing is open stack. integrating its products with OpenStack and made significant contributions to the OpenStack community, helping the software meet enterprise and cloud including OpenStack Object Storage. In a cloud computing environment, it acts as a controller, which manages all the resources in a virtual environment. It provides an operating platform for orchestrating service provider requirements. OpenStack Identity standardize and simplify the user interface (UI), both for individual it's easy to extend storage clusters with additional servers, as required. OpenStack Cloud Architecture and Deployment teaches you how to deploy, administer, and use the core OpenStack services. Featuring a containerised control plane, optional hyper-converged architecture, model-driven operations and upgrades to future OpenStack releases guaranteed, the OpenStack cloud from Canonical is the fast track to private cloud success. instances use. renamed Neutron. services, including PostgreSQL, MySQL, Redis, blob storage, elastic Cinder. Cloud computing is the delivery of on-demand computing resources, everything from applications to data centers, over the internet.